Dr. Ron Diftler

Dr. Ron Diftler serves as the Robonaut Project Leader at NASA’s Johnson Space Center. Robonaut is a human-scale space robotic system designed to assist astronauts before, during, and after space walks. The Robonaut Team’s latest robot, Robonaut 2 (R2), is the culmination of 15 years of NASA Robonaut development and a highly successful partnership with General Motors (GM). In addition to collaboration with GM, Dr. Diftler led his team through previous collaborations with the Defense Advanced Research Projects Agency (DARPA), Johns Hopkins University, Vanderbilt University, the Massachusetts Institute of Technology, the University of Massachusetts, the University of Southern California, Rice University, and the Institute for Human-Machine Cognition.
